对喜马拉雅长叶松种子进行24小时GA3和H2O2浸泡预处理和15d的2-3℃低温预处理后,研究了在20℃,25℃和30℃萌发条件下,21个不同种源的喜马拉雅长叶松种子的萌发情况。结果表明,H2O2(1%v/v)和GA3(10mg/L)浸泡预处理,种子萌发率分别是82.39%和78.19%,而未经预处理的种子平均萌发率为70.79%。GA3和H2O2浸泡预处理分别使种子萌发时间缩短了8d和10d。在超过21天的20℃萌发条件下,湿冷处理提高了种子萌发率和缩短了萌发时间;而在25℃和30℃萌发条件下,总的萌发率未受到影响。喜马拉雅长叶松种子因缺少休眠而表现出很好的萌发,但是因为越来越多的造林项目需要大量的种子,播种预处理有利于提高种子萌发率和萌发速率,有助于满足种子需求。
Himalayan seeds were subjected to pretreatment with GA3 and H2O2 for 24 hours and pretreated with 2-3 ℃ for 15 days. The results showed that 21 Himalayan species with different provenances at 20 ℃, 25 ℃ and 30 ℃ germinated Ye Song seed germination. The results showed that the germination rates of seeds were 82.39% and 78.19%, respectively, with pretreatment of H2O2 (1% v / v) and GA3 (10 mg / L), while the average germination rate of seeds without pretreatment was 70.79%. Pretreatment with GA3 and H2O2 shortened seed germination time by 8 and 10 d, respectively. Under the condition of germination at 20 ℃ for more than 21 days, the wet and cold treatment increased the seed germination rate and shorten the germination time; while the germination rate was not affected under the germination conditions of 25 ℃ and 30 ℃. Himalayan planted seeds show good germination due to lack of dormancy, but because more and more afforestation projects require large amounts of seeds, sowing pretreatment is beneficial to improve seed germination rate and germination rate and help to meet the needs of seeds.
